D.C. Pronk If I had only one style in music to express myself, wouldn't I be a very limited person? The same age as Michael Jackson and born the same year as Barbie. Fidel Castro took over power in Cuba. The first sessions for Ella Fitzgerald's George and Ira Gershwin Songbook are held. Singing classes at school were torture. My voice trembled and I sang off key. I peed my pants. Classmates had a good laugh. At 18 or so I got me a guitar and started strumming and singing just for fun. 15 years later I was confident enough to perform on my birthday party. Everybody was drunk, including me. Whether it was a success I can't remember. I was too drunk... At the age of 55, I decided it was time for me to go serious about it. Took some singing lessons, and bought me some software and equipment. The results are on this site. Crawling through music's history to create something new and personal. All instruments were created with my computer and synth software. D.C. Pronk’s tracks Bastille Day by D.C. Pronk published on 2026-03-16T18:13:17Z 33 cars (pizza anyone?) by D.C.
